Ovelia Psistaria continues to offer delicious modern Greek specialties such as loukaniko, spanakopita, pikilia dips, the lamburgini and more
Ovelia Psistaria continues to offer delicious modern Greek specialties such as loukaniko, spanakopita, pikilia dips, the lamburgini and more